The Cambridge Technicals in IT offers a creative and inspiring vocational qualification as a high quality, work focused alternative to A Levels. The course is for students who prefer to study IT in a context that allows them to develop practical skills and knowledge relevant to modern businesses. It has been developed in partnership with major employers in the industry resulting in a challenging Level 3 IT qualification which equips students with relevant skills. There are three externally assessed units plus a choice of two further units, which are internally assessed. It is designed to give learners a range of specialist knowledge and transferable skills in the field of applied IT, providing them with the opportunity to enter an apprenticeship, move directly into employment, or progress to a related higher education course.
